The global PEEK market is projected to grow from USD 1.67 billion in 2026 to USD 2.29 billion by 2031, at a CAGR of 6.4% during the forecast period. Polyether ether ketone (PEEK) is a high-performance, semi-crystalline thermoplastic polymer known for its exceptional mechanical strength, chemical resistance, and thermal stability. Available in unfilled, glass-filled, and carbon-filled variants, each type serves a specific purpose: the unfilled version offers purity and flexibility; glass-filled enhances strength and stability; and carbon-filled improves stiffness and wear resistance. PEEK can be processed through extrusion and injection molding and is utilized across various industries. In electronics, it is valued for insulation and thermal resistance; in aerospace, it provides lightweight, high-strength components; in automotive, it offers durability and chemical resistance; and in oil and gas, it withstands harsh environments. Additionally, PEEK is used in the medical field for its biocompatibility. The demand for lightweight, high-performance materials across industries and technological advancements are expected to drive growth in the PEEK market.

Driver: Expanding adoption of medical-grade PEEK in implants, surgical devices, and patient-specific healthcare solutions
The adoption of medical-grade PEEK over the last decade has significantly contributed to market growth. Its biocompatibility, sterilization resistance, and mechanical strength, which are comparable to those of human bone, make it an ideal material for use in implants, surgical instruments, and custom-fabricated medical devices. The increasing demand for advanced healthcare technologies, along with a shift from generalized care to more individualized treatment options, is driving the need for these prosthetic devices.
Restraint: Competition from alternative high-performance polymers and advanced composite materials
The PEEK market faces competition from a variety of high-performance polymers and advanced composite materials that provide similar performance characteristics at lower costs or offer specific advantages for certain applications. Materials such as polyimides, polyphenylene sulfide (PPS), and carbon-fiber-reinforced composites are increasingly being considered in industries such as automotive, aerospace, and electronics. This competitive environment may restrict the widespread adoption of PEEK in applications that are sensitive to cost.
Opportunity: Increasing replacement of metals in lightweight and corrosion-resistant applications
The increasing focus on lightweight, durable, and corrosion-resistant materials offers significant opportunities for the PEEK market. Industries such as aerospace, automotive, oil and gas, and industrial manufacturing are progressively substituting traditional metal components with high-performance polymers. This shift aims to improve fuel efficiency, reduce maintenance needs, and enhance product longevity. PEEK’s excellent strength-to-weight ratio and resistance to harsh operating environments make it a promising alternative to metals in various applications.
Challenge: Environmental concerns related to plastic usage and disposal
Environmental concerns related to plastic consumption and disposal pose significant challenges for the PEEK market. While PEEK is recognized for its durability and long service life, increasing regulatory scrutiny and heightened public awareness surrounding plastic waste and sustainability are driving manufacturers to prioritize recycling, material recovery, and environmentally responsible production practices. Balancing these sustainability issues with the need to maintain performance standards continues to be a critical challenge for market participants.

MARKET ECOSYSTEM
The PEEK market is characterized by a concentrated yet highly integrated value chain that connects specialty polymer manufacturers, raw material suppliers, distributors, and end-user industries. At the upstream level, raw material suppliers such as Wanlong Chemical and OYI provide key intermediates required for PEEK production. Leading manufacturers, including Victrex, Evonik, Mitsubishi Chemical Group, Syensqo, and ZYPEEK, drive innovation, capacity expansion, and material development, supplying high-performance PEEK grades for demanding applications. Distributors such as Emco Industrial Plastics, Thomas, and PolymerShapes play a critical role in extending market reach and providing technical support to regional customers. On the demand side, gear and industrial component manufacturers, including IMS Gear, Elecon, Miba, and ATA Gears, utilize PEEK for its exceptional mechanical strength, wear resistance, chemical stability, and lightweight properties. The ecosystem demonstrates strong collaboration across the value chain, with manufacturers and end users increasingly working together to develop application-specific solutions for automotive, industrial, aerospace, medical, and electronics markets.

PEEK Market, by End User
The automotive segment is expected to grow rapidly due to the rising demand for lightweight, durable, and high-performance materials. PEEK is increasingly used in gears, bearings, seals, bushings, transmission components, and electrical connectors because of its superior mechanical strength and resistance to chemicals, corrosion, and heat. This enables the replacement of heavier metal parts with lightweight polymers without compromising vehicle performance. The push for vehicle lightweighting to improve fuel economy and reduce emissions will further increase PEEK's usage. Additionally, the growth of electric and hybrid vehicles presents new opportunities for PEEK in battery systems and electrical components, necessitating increased production capacity to meet demand.
PEEK Market, by Reinforcement Type
Glass-filled PEEK is anticipated to be the fastest-growing segment of the global PEEK market due to its exceptional mechanical properties and diverse applications. It is significantly stronger, stiffer, and more chemically resistant than unfilled PEEK, making it ideal for industries like aerospace, automotive, electrical and electronics, and oil and gas. The demand for lightweight and durable materials to improve fuel efficiency is driving the use of glass-filled PEEK in components such as structural parts, gears, and seals. Its enhanced insulation and heat resistance also benefit electrical and electronics applications like connectors and switches. Industries in harsh environments prefer glass-filled PEEK for its resilience to load and temperature changes. As the need for high-performance materials grows, the rising preference for glass-filled PEEK is boosting overall market growth and encouraging further material innovation.

RECENT DEVELOPMENTS
- March 2025 : Syensqo and Politubes Srl announced a strategic partnership to develop slot liner spiral-wound tubes using Ajedium polyether ether ketone (PEEK) and polyphenylsulfone (PPSU) film. These spiral-wound slot liner tubes leverage the high-performance properties of Ajedium PEEK films, providing superior insulation for electric motors.
- March 2024 : DEMGY Group and Drake Plastics formed the "Liberty Alliance," a partnership to expand high-performance polymer solutions. DEMGY becomes the preferred distributor in France for Drake’s machinable semi-finished shapes, offering turnkey solutions. The product portfolio includes extruded bars, sheets, Seamless Tube and near-net-shapes from special formulations of PEEK and polyketone, as well as Torlon polyamide-imide and other high-performance polymers. The partnership strengthens both companies’ market reach in aerospace, mobility, and semiconductors, providing high-quality, cost-effective technical solutions globally.
- October 2023 : Victrex plc launched a new product grade developed exclusively for drug delivery and pharmaceutical contact applications. The new product grade, VICTREX PC 101, is a PEEK-based material ideally suited to non-implantable pharmaceutical contact and drug delivery applications with less than 24-hour tissue contact.
- October 2023 : Evonik introduced a new carbon-fiber-reinforced PEEK filament for use in 3D-printed medical implants. This smart biomaterial can be processed in common extrusion-based 3D printing technologies such as fused filament fabrication (FFF).

Market Definition
Polyether ether ketone (PEEK) is a high-performance, semi-crystalline thermoplastic polymer known for its excellent mechanical strength, thermal stability, chemical resistance, and flame retardancy. It is widely utilized in demanding engineering applications due to its ability to maintain performance under extreme conditions. PEEK is available in several reinforcement types, including unfilled polyether ether ketone (pure PEEK), glass-filled polyether ether ketone for improved rigidity and dimensional stability, and carbon-filled polyether ether ketone for enhanced strength, stiffness, and thermal conductivity. The polymer is processed through advanced methods such as injection molding and extrusion, which allow for the production of complex components with high precision. Owing to its superior properties, PEEK finds extensive applications across various end-use industries, including electrical and electronics, aerospace, automotive, oil and gas, and medical. These industries leverage PEEK’s performance benefits for parts such as insulators, connectors, engine components, implants, and seals, making it a critical material in high-reliability environments.
